Is
it just me, or has Season 5 of America’s
Next Top Model “jumped the shark” now
that the Sarah-Kim affair is over?
The
show was a bit of a snooze last night. Yes, Coryn got
in Lisa’s face, Janice Dickinson made Lisa cry,
Evil Jay was wearing so much pancake makeup that he
looked like a spray-tanned porcelain doll, but none
of it measured up to the prime-time sapphistry we’ve
been served in previous weeks.
Without
the illicit gay love, the episode was kind of a downer.
In
the opening voice over, Tyra suggests that “Sarah
was eliminated because she became distracted by her
crush on Kim.” Back at Chez Model, Kim admits
that she might have deserved elimination more than Sarah.
As
is often the case when someone who is not a raving bitch
gets eliminated, the girls are down in the dumps. So
they do what we all do when we need to lift our spirits.
They
pose for topless pictures!
It’s
“Models Gone Wild,” with the girls ripping
off their tops and hanging all over each other. Kim
somehow ends up in the middle of each shot, flanked
by her semi-naked honeys. Self-designated photographer
Diane tells Kim, “You look like a pimp!”
Meanwhile,
Lisa is setting up a mini-liquor mart in her
bedroom. The only catch is that none of it’s for
sale. Or for sharing. She wants to keep the dozens of
bottles of booze all to herself. She’s going to
need them for later, when she gets loaded and points
out all of the other models’ flaws.
Propped
up in her deck chair, Lisa has lots of alcohol-inspired
wisdom for her housemates. Diane humors her, but Coryn
is not going to play it that way.
Lisa
bluntly tells Coryn “You need to stop working
out.”
Coryn: “No I don’t.”
Well,
she probably DOES need to stop working out. She is so
skinny and ripped that she looks like human jerky. And
maybe if Lisa pointed this out privately, with genuine
concern for Coryn’s health instead of slurring
it out at top voice in front of everyone, the comment
might be acceptable.
But
it’s not like that.
Lisa
tells Coryn that she looks hard, and that she has a
screwed up perception of her body because she thinks
she’s fat but she’s actually too skinny.
Lisa
has already told us (ad nauseam) that she just wants
to help the other girls out, even if only to make it
more meaningful when she defeats each and every one
of them. So it’s no surprise that she caps her
graceless critique with, “For your advantage,
it would best if you just ate and didn’t work
out.”
While
I can personally attest to Lisa’s suggested fitness
regimen, I don’t think Coryn is going to go for
it.
Coryn:
“Why would I listen to someone I’m competing
against?”
Cut
to kind and forgiving Diane, “When Lisa drinks,
she just lets herself come out a little bit more.”
Actually,
it looks like Lisa might have a drinking problem. But
if this is the case, I’m sure it will be handled
with the same high-minded sensitivity with which Michelle’s
flesh-eating virus---I mean, impetigo—was handled
by the other models last season.
